Excellent Rental Data Centres to simulate a DR (Disaster Recovery) operation .
SunGard provides DR (Disaster Recovery) services at it's data centers. The service is for companies who do not maintain their own dedicated DR sites and need to rent one to conduct a DR exercise for validating it's DR setup. These centers have state of the art equipment with all possible hardware options and one needs to define their specific requirements. Companies can rent their hardware cages at SunGard Site and have options to replicate their critical data at the DR site periodically. They can then simulate the DR exercise when desired. Additionally Tape restores are also possible at the DR site.

Easy to work and offers features for tape backups, disk backups, and whatever you want
NovaStor NovaBACKUP is still working on new features because they listen to the customers and integrate their needs into new versions. You can see they make progress with each new version. They are much faster than IBM, where you sometimes have to wait years for new features. It is very quick and fast. NovaStor have big competitors like Veeam, which is very fast and aggressive. It's good, but it depends on the price. I think NovaStor might be cheaper. They have a direct connection to their developers and sales teams, which makes getting answers very fast. Veeam has a lot of features, like a special reporting tool. However, I've heard from some customers that Veeam wasn't always the right decision because it couldn't work with their environment. But Veeam has aggressive marketing, which is why they are probably in first place at the moment, besides Commvault. IBM has lost its competitive edge and is trying to catch up, but it might be too late.
